Maybe used game sales are actually good for the industry?
Posted on February 23, 2010 | No CommentsWhat is it with publishers fascination with second-hand sales? Yes, for every used video game you buy on eBay, the publisher sees zero dollars and zero cents, but are they operating at such razor-thin margins that teens auctioning off their old PSP games is worth their attention? You don't see Ford or GM or Toyota or Honda or anything complaining about used cars sales, do you? (Actually, do you? I know next to nothing about cars.) Electronic Arts' "Project Ten Dollar" was concocted to battle against the scourge of second-hand video game sales, forcing gamers to pay upward of $10 for DLC that usually comes for free alongside the purchase of a new video game. Turns out, not only does it hurt consumers and retailers, but it hurts publishers in the long run!

iPhone Football Faceoff: EA’s Madden NFL 2010 vs. Gameloft’s NFL 2010
Posted on September 11, 2009 | No Comments
Holy Mother of Football Heaven. Talk about a head-to-head matchup. Gaming heavyweight Electronic Arts against mobile superstar Gameloft. We've seen this before, folks, on various mobile devices. But never on a stage like this. And never with the stakes so high. The iPhone is the ultimate arena for this blockbuster duel, and we're going to judge this match play-by-play for you. We'll go through each of the major aspects of a quality simulation football game and tell you how each game scored. But first, a little background on the contestants:
EA is the owner and developer for the best (and only) football franchise in the world, Madden NFL Football. They've also kicked ass on the iPhone platform with titles such as The Sims 3, Need for Speed, Tiger Woods PGA Tour, and more. Gameloft, despite having far less success with their football franchise, has managed to dominate the iPhone platform. Gameloft has racked up more than 6 million sales with titles such as Gangstar, Rise of Lost Empires, Assassin’s Creed: Altair’s Chronicles, and others. This will be a truly epic battle, but nobody can deny that EA, what with more than a decade of experience with the Madden franchise, is favored in the bout of a lifetime: EA's Madden NFL 2010 head-to-head with Gameloft's NFL 2010.
